Cursive Logar 6 is a light, very narrow, medium contrast, italic, very short x-height font.

A delicate, slanted script with long, tapering strokes and a pen-like rhythm. Letterforms are built from quick, sweeping curves and sharp, hairline joins, with occasional heavier pressure on downstrokes that gives the writing a lively, calligraphic texture. Capitals are tall and gestural, often starting with extended entry strokes, while lowercase forms stay compact with small counters and minimal looping, contributing to a tight, wiry color on the line. Spacing and widths feel natural and handwritten, with irregular proportions that keep the texture animated rather than mechanically uniform.

Best suited to short display settings where the airy strokework and expressive capitals can be appreciated—logos, signatures, product packaging, invitations, and editorial headlines. It can also work for brief pull quotes or social graphics when set with generous size and spacing to preserve clarity.

The overall tone is refined yet casual—like a fast handwritten note done with a pointed pen. Its thin strokes and swift movement feel intimate and stylish, leaning toward fashion-forward, romantic, and slightly dramatic rather than friendly-rounded or cartoonish.

The design appears intended to emulate quick, elegant handwriting with a pointed-pen feel—prioritizing motion, personality, and a distinctive silhouette over strict regularity. Its emphasis on sweeping capitals and fine strokes suggests use as an accent voice for premium, personal, or boutique branding.

The glyph set shows strong forward motion and frequent stroke crossings in capitals, which creates a striking signature-like silhouette at display sizes. Numerals follow the same cursive logic, with simple, flowing forms that match the letter rhythm.
